Debutante Pretty Moi would be interesting if supported here, though she is not a standout in terms of an All Weather pedigree and preference is for NIGHT SPARK, who proved himself on the track last time and could do better over this longer trip. Love Rat is a likely danger to the selection, while Dichato is not as easy to assess on his Fibresand debut, but keep an eye on the market for any obvious confidence in him.
